Chandigarh, September 26, 2025: Olympian Sanjay, representing the Centre of Excellence, Hockey Chandigarh, was felicitated in a special meeting with Punjab Governor and UT Administrator Gulab Chand Kataria here at the Punjab Raj Bhavan. The Governor recognized Sanjay’s remarkable achievement of winning a gold medal at the Asia Cup 2025, calling it another shining milestone in his distinguished career.
Extending his best wishes, Governor Kataria lauded Sanjay’s journey from Chandigarh’s hockey academy to the international podium, describing it as a true inspiration for aspiring athletes across the region. He also praised the coach for his dedicated mentorship in nurturing talent with discipline and teamwork.
The felicitation meet was attended by President of Hockey Chandigarh, Karan Gilhotra, and Vice President Anil Vohra, who briefed the Governor about Sanjay’s journey and the role of the Chandigarh Centre of Excellence in producing world-class players.
Sharing his thoughts, President of Chandigarh Hockey, Karan Gilhotra, remarked, “Sanjay’s perseverance and achievements are a matter of great pride for Hockey Chandigarh. His dedication sets a benchmark for young hockey aspirants.”
The occasion highlighted Chandigarh’s growing status as a sports powerhouse and reaffirmed the administration’s commitment to supporting athletes, while also acknowledging the contributions of sports leaders like Gilhotra and Vohra.
In an emotional note, Sanjay expressed gratitude for the recognition and thanked the Chandigarh Administration for its continuous support.
